Earthquake details
Tuesday, June 26, 1979 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Afghanistan on Tuesday, June 26, 1979 at 03:04 UTC with a magnitude of 5.7. The closest known location in the current dataset is Fayzabad (Afghanistan - AF), about 91.3 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 71.218 and latitude 36.475.
